I started by pulling out my MISTI…if you haven’t heard about this stamping tool, it’s pretty awesome!  I inked up the flower image from the Awesomely Artistic stamp set in StazOn Jet Black Ink and I stamped it with my MISTI twice in the exact same spot on two panels of Very Vanilla card stock.

I inked the dragonfly image from the Awesomely Artistic stamp set in Crumb Cake ink and I stamped it on the two panels with my MISTI.  Then I cut 3/4″ off all four sides of one of the panels.

I colored the flower images with my Blushing Bride, So Saffron and Pear Pizzazz Stampin’ Write Markers, adhered the larger panel to a panel of Pear Pizzazz card stock with SNAIL, then to a Blushing Bride card base with Stampin’ Dimensionals.

I stamped the sentiment from the Awesomely Artistic stamp set in Pear Pizzazz ink on the smaller panel, adhered that panel to a panel of Pear Pizzazz card stock, then to the card front with SNAIL.  I added a single Metal Rimmed Pearl to the lower right side of the smaller panel to finish the card front.

I stamped the dragonfly image from the Awesomely Artistic stamp set in Crumb Cake ink on a Very Vanilla card stock panel inside the card.

Card stock cuts for this project:
  • Blushing Bride – 4-1/4″ x 11″ card base
  • Pear Pizzazz – 4″ x 5-1/4″ panel, 2-3/4″ x 3-3/4″ panel
  • Very Vanilla – 2-3/8″ x 3-5/8″ panel, 4″ x 5-1/4″ panel (inside card)
